How long can I continue step aerobics?


by Sandra Greiner
Prenatal Fitness Instructor
Sandra Greiner


Question

I am one-month pregnant with my third child. I did mild exercise with the previous pregnancies, but for the last 4 months I have been taking a one-hour step aerobic class. It is quite strenous, but a good workout for me. Can I continue and if so, how can I protect my pregnancy? - Sherri, Gaylord

Answer

Step aerobics is a fun form of exercise. If you feel up to the challenge, you may continue as long as you pay attention to how you feel and modify your workout intensity accordingly. Some women develop knee discomfort as ligaments loosen. In the last trimester you may want to lower the step or choose another class.

Water aerobics is a challenging workout, yet much more appropriate for the pregnant body.
